When does the 2025 college football season start? Week 0 games, storylines to know about opening weekend

Getty Images

The 2025 college football season will kick off 150 days from now on Saturday, Aug. 23, as Week 0 action gets things underway. There are four matchups taking place on the opening weekend, headlined by the Aer Lingus College Football Classic in Dublin. 

Last season, Florida State’s miserable 2-10 campaign kicked off with a surprising loss to Georgia Tech, a matchup that had a major impact on both programs. SMU also started its run to the College Football Playoff in Week 0 with a win over Nevada. 

Here are the games to watch during the 2025 Week 0 slate, including a pivotal conference matchup and the debut of three new coaches. 

Iowa State vs. Kansas State (Ireland)

The Big 12 rivalry, affectionately dubbed “Farmageddon,” will take place in Dublin, Ireland, to kick off the 2025 season with the Aer Lingus College Football Classic. Led by coaches Chris Klieman and Matt Campbell, the pair sit as perennial conference championship contenders with exciting young quarterbacks Rocco Becht and Avery Johnson. Iowa State has won four of the last five matchups, making this a pivotal game that could shake up the Big 12 title and CFP races.
